The Family Assistance Program for Alcona and Iosco Counties, issued under solicitation number RFP-491-260000002381-1 by the State of Michigan’s Department of Health and Human Services, is a three-year service contract with an effective start date of October 1, 2026, and a potential term extending through September 30, 2029, with options for two additional one-year renewals at the State’s discretion. The contract has a fixed annual award value of $50,000, totaling $150,000 over the base period, and requires contractors to deliver comprehensive family support services across Michigan, including Ingham County, with performance occurring at client homes, community locations, and other designated sites as needed. Proposals must demonstrate strong delivery capability, including staffing plans aligned with detailed service charts, clear timelines for service initiation, and an actionable plan for client engagement through both face-to-face and non-face-to-face contacts, while also proving a deep understanding of the target population’s needs and the feasibility of the proposed service methodology. The evaluation is conducted on a best-value basis, awarding up to 125 technical points based on delivery capability (40 points), service capability and understanding (40 points), compliance with vendor worksheet instructions (30 points), and relevant experience and past performance with the State (15 points); proposals must achieve a minimum of 100 technical points to be eligible for award, and price is considered alongside technical merit without adherence to a lowest-price, technically acceptable model. Contractors are required to comply with stringent operational, security, and administrative regulations, including mandatory background checks for all personnel with disclosure requirements for any CPS history, criminal convictions, or prior perpetrator findings, with immediate reporting obligations for any new incidents. All employees and subcontractors must pass screening against state databases including ICHAT and CR, and those without a ten-year Michigan residency must sign a felony waiver. Insurance must include commercial general liability, automobile liability, and workers’ compensation coverage with minimum limits, naming the State as an additional insured with a waiver of subrogation, and all insurers must hold an A.M. Best rating of A- or better. The contract imposes strict data privacy requirements aligned with Michigan’s Digital Standards and GRC platform compliance, mandating 24-hour breach reporting, secure handling and destruction of confidential information upon termination, and retention of all records for four years following final payment
